For sale: 2003 Land Rover Discovery SE7, black on black, approximately 119,300 miles on the odometer. Located in Los Gatos, CA.

This vehicle was a daily driver for my wife from new until May 2013.

In 2010 at ~95K miles, the head gasket blew, the engine overheated and slipped a cylinder liner. We paid over $6,000 to have the engine replaced with a new block, so there are approximately 25K miles on this engine. About March of 2013, we started hearing the tell-tale signs that there may be a leak in the head gasket again (gurgling in the heater core loop during acceleration from a stop), so we drove it gingerly for a few months before purchasing another vehicle. Since then, this one has sat on the street, driven occaisionally for trips to the hardware store. The coolant has never run low with the new engine so this engine probably just needs a new head gasket.

The pads and rotors have been replaced all around within the last 20K, along with the power steering pump.

The right front window regulator was replaced recently. All windows work well.

The SLS system was converted to coils (reversible if you please).

There is a small current leak somewhere, so the battery will discharge if not driven daily. I suspect the culprit is an aftermarket Alpine/BMW to iPod adapter (I have the original CD changer).

The right side of the vehicle has some water spots on the paint from being hit by sprinklers. These can be buffed away. The right front bumper made contact with a parking garage bollard, and it is cracked and needs to be replaced. There are two small “keyed”-like scratches on the right rear door that can use some touching-up/buffing. There is some peeling under the windshield on the left side.

The interior is in good shape, the most significant issue is a little fabric wear on the left rear door panel. There are all-weather (rubber) mats all-around. The vehicle also comes with removable roof rack cross-bar rails.
